How much do senior software eng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 7,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ior software engineer in Dunlap, IL is $141,849.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$121,300.00 and $159,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a senior software engineer?

A senior software engineer designs, codes, tests, and maintains computer software. While these are your primary responsibilities as a senior software engineer, you may also have supervisory duties. These include overseeing a team of junior software engineers or developers. The senior software engineer title is sometimes used interchangeably with senior developer, and positions for both may share similar job duties and responsibilities. In general, software engineers are distinguished from developers in that software engineers apply engineering principles to software development.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ior software eng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Software Engineer, you need advanced programming skills, deep understanding of software architecture, and several years of experience in software development,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with tools like Git, CI/CD pipelines, cloud platforms, and expertise in technologies such as Java, Python, or JavaScript are typically required. Leadership, problem-solving,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for mentoring teams and collaborating across departments. These skills ensure the delivery of robust, scalable solutions and drive successful project outcomes in complex technical environments.

What does a senior software engineer do?

A senior software engineer designs, develops, and maintains software applications, often leading projects and mentoring junior team members. They analyze requirements, write code, perform testing, and coll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ure quality and efficiency. Proficiency in programming languages, problem-solving skills, and experience with development tools are essential for this role.

Job description

NVIDIA's products, hardware and software, are world leaders for performance and efficiency. We are continually innovating in creative and unique ways to improve our ability to deliver extraordinary solutions across a wide range of sectors.

We are seeking System Software Engineers who are passionate about what they do and are committed to making a difference in the world through their inventions. In the Software Development Tools Team, we enable 1st & 3rd-party developers to turn NVIDIA's hardware into groundbreaking cluster, server, professional, consumer, automotive, and embedded solutions.

What you will be doing:

This position will be enhancing and expanding advanced analysis tools for our system-wide profiling tools. Implementation will be primarily in Python, with a strong need for C++ from time to time. You'll work with customers and engineers across teams to explore problems, find solutions, write functional requirements docs and designs, drive execution, and deliver multi-functional software solutions. Partner with system architects, product definition engineers, software/firmware engineers, HW/SW applications engineers and operations, in a multifaceted, dynamic, high-energy work environment to bring industry-defining products to market. Be involved with the premiere multi-discipline GPU+CPU+networking profiling tool in the industry. You will have the opportunity to work with researchers and real world developers who are doing important work to improve computers and computing systems. Build software tools that enable developers across a spectrum of markets to optimize their workflows; enable complex computer systems doing ongoing work in High Performance Computing(HPC), Machine Learning, Deep Learning, Artificial Intelligence, Autonomous Machines, pro-visualization, and even entertainment. Enable work in tiny embedded and automotive systems. Our tools span the gamut.
